Capcom’s Lead For Ace Attorney Trilogy & Mega Man Star Force Games Leaves Company

The name Shinsuke Kodama may be familiar for those who loved Capcom’s visual novels and RPGs. He’s renowned for being the game designer for the Mega Man Star Force games and the director for the Phoenix Wright: Ace Attorney Trilogy, as well as designed the Professor Layton VS Phoenix Wright crossover.

Welp, turns out he left the company this February “to pursue a new challenge”. He states on Twitter that he wishes to continue supporting the Ace Attorney games from the outside.

I can’t say I have much love for the Mega Man Star Force series, but I do love me some Ace Attorney courtroom action, even if it isn’t an accurate representation of real-life legal battles. All the best, Kodama-san!
